Abstract

 The development of cystic lesions in the maxillo-facial regions is influenced by a complex interplay of etiological factors, including infectious, traumatic, genetic, and environmental components. Understanding these contributing factors is essential for accurate diagnosis, effective treatment planning, and prevention of recurrence. This review explores recent research on the pathogenic mechanisms underlying the formation of maxillofacial cysts, emphasizing the roles of microbial infections, genetic predispositions, traumatic injuries, and chemical or environmental influences. An integrated approach to identifying these etiological aspects can improve clinical outcomes and guide targeted therapeutic interventions, ultimately contributing to better management of maxillo-facial cystic diseases.
